Selling Strategies for Samsung Phones with Accidental Damage

When it comes to selling Samsung phones with accidental damage, understanding the right strategies can significantly improve your chances of a successful sale. Whether you’re a private seller or a retailer, knowing how to present and price damaged devices is crucial.

Assessing the Damage

The first step is to thoroughly evaluate the extent of the damage. Common issues include cracked screens, water damage, battery problems, or malfunctioning buttons. Document all damages accurately to inform potential buyers and determine the device’s value.

Pricing Strategies

Pricing damaged Samsung phones requires careful consideration. Factors to consider include the model’s market value, the severity of the damage, and the cost of repairs. Typically, damaged devices are sold at a significant discount—often 30% to 60% below the retail price.

Setting Realistic Prices

Use online marketplaces to research similar damaged phones and their selling prices. Be transparent about the damage and set a fair price to attract serious buyers quickly.

Marketing Damaged Samsung Phones

Effective marketing is essential when selling damaged phones. Highlight the device’s good features, such as original accessories, clean IMEI, or remaining warranty. Use clear photos showing the damage from multiple angles.

Creating Honest Listings

Be honest about the damage in your product descriptions. Transparency builds trust with buyers and reduces disputes after the sale. Include details about what is working and what is not.

Choosing the Right Sales Channels

Select platforms that cater to damaged or refurbished devices. Popular options include eBay, Swappa, and specialized electronics resellers. Each platform has different fee structures and buyer pools, so choose accordingly.

Benefits of Online Marketplaces

  • Wider reach to potential buyers
  • Secure payment options
  • Built-in buyer protection policies

Preparing the Device for Sale

Before listing, perform a factory reset to protect your personal information. Clean the device physically to improve its appearance and increase buyer interest. Include all original accessories if available.
